我只是想知道,因为我想学习电脑等….
日志文件保存在web服务器中的时间有多长,我的意思是保持input到网页的传入IP连接的注册文件,它是永久性的,或者在一段时间后被删除
说有人在他的一生中曾经进入一个网页,而且从来没有回来过,一个知道服务器用IP地址和date时间logging日志的人,但是等了多长时间后,会说1年后会发生什么呢?
我听说过有关日志文件需要的服务器或内存空间,这些都起着重要的作用,因为我听说在小页面中,服务器将日志保留3周,然后呢?
谢谢
这取决于您使用的技术,您可能拥有的法律要求,或者可能正在使用的公司和/或业务策略和实践。
我们在Windows上运行IIS,因此没有内置的日志pipe理function。 我们没有法律或业务要求来保存日志文件,所以我有一个重复执行的任务设置为删除30天以前的所有日志文件。 我们随时保留最近30天的日志文件,以便进行跟踪和故障排除。 我的想法是,如果在过去30天内我没有必要查看这些日志文件,那么我可能就不需要看它们了。
许多地方都有关于允许您将日志文件保持原始状态的时间的政策。 对于美国政府来说,在旋转日志30天后。 (除非你有一个非常安静的服务器,否则永远不会旋转你的日志。)
IP地址实际上并没有长时间(几年的规模)保持有用 – 人们移动networking,所以如果你想识别关于用户的任何信息(例如,他们来自哪个国家/公司等)从),您需要在访问时或不久之后进行查找。
公司也可能会在人们可读的政策声明或P3P文件中提供有关其保留策略的信息(请参阅保留;这不是特定的时间,但是如果他们永久保留日志,立即销毁或在某处在之间)
日志文件保存在web服务器中的时间有多长,我的意思是保持input到网页的传入IP连接的注册文件,它是永久性的,或者在一段时间后被删除
完全取决于系统pipe理员如何设置。 在设置轮转时,有些人会保持4周的logging,有些则保持4年。 大多数情况下,日志也会备份到磁带(或其他备份介质)上,所以根据磁带的旋转和过期,日志可能会存在很长时间。
说有人在他的一生中曾经进入一个网页,而且从来没有回来过,一个知道服务器用IP地址和date时间logging日志的人,但是等了多长时间后,会说1年后会发生什么呢?
再次,完全取决于事情的configuration。
我听说过有关日志文件需要的服务器或内存空间,这些都起着重要作用?因为我听说在小页面中,服务器将日志保留3周,然后又是什么?
大多数日志轮换系统能够压缩不活动的日志文件。 由于日志只是文本/ ASCII数据,它们压缩得非常好,通常不占用太多的空间。 也就是说,当你的网站stream量突然增加并最终用日志文件填满你的分区时,肯定有可能。 这就是为什么build议将日志保留在单独的分区上的原因。 这样,如果填满,它不会影响其他应用程序。
实际上在pipe理不善的系统上:直到磁盘满了,然后清理。 😉